DPs disembark from USS General W. M. Black (AP-135) in New York Harbor, United States.

First DPs (Displaced Persons) arrive in New York, U.S. Refugees from World War 2 allowed to enter New York, United States under new quota as they arrive aboard USS General W. M. Black (AP-135). USS General W. M. Black in New York Harbor. Gangway is set into place. U.S. Attorney General Tom Clark shakes hands with different people in the background. DPs (Displaced Persons) disembark from ship. DPs on deck of ship.

First DPs (Displaced Persons) aboard USS General W. M. Black (AP-135) enter New York Harbor, United States.

First DPs (Displaced Persons) arrive in New York, U.S. DPs allowed to enter United States under new quota arrive aboard USS General W. M. Black (AP-135). A fireboat sends up a spray to welcome DPs in New York Harbor. Statue of Liberty in the background. A ferry and railroad barge pass by in the foreground. USS General W. M. Black makes its way up the North River. New York skyline in the background.
